ChamberConnect: Navigating the New Normal – Employee Engagement

ChamberConnect is a series of interactive virtual events which have been designed to support businesses and their staff through the current Coronavirus crisis.

These events will allow you to learn, ask questions and stay up-to-date on a variety of topics which will be affecting your business at such an uncertain time.

 

Tune in via video conference app Zoom to hear from Nicola Ellwood of Ellwood Performance & Mastery.

1. How to get clear on your new team norm, and communicate so the teams feels engaged and motivated toward it.

2. Enabling productivity and wellbeing in your people as you make the move away from work from home

3. Easing the transition – how to help team members make the transition and overcome the barriers to change. Input and brief HR consideration when helping your people make the transition back

Nicola is an Executive Coach who helps leaders lead their organisation by showing up as their best engaging, high performing version. Alongside being a specialist in mindset and communication, she trains managers and leaders in the interpersonal skills and conditions required to create engaging, highly productive cultures within their team.

In this interactive session there will be plenty of opportunity for questions, and Nicola will be inviting questions whilst being interviewed by Adam Davey; Founder and Director of Petaurum HR who will add to Nicola’s content with brief insight from an HR perspective.
